I've found this one from Raptor: https://quickbuild.io/~raptor-engineering-public/+archive/ubuntu/chromium/+build/543247 and got excited because it's recent 2022-05-15 and updated version.
I've tried downloading and installing the following packages:
chromium-101.0.4951.64-2.ppc64le.rpm chromium-driver-101.0.4951.64-2.ppc64le.rpm
chromium-common-101.0.4951.64-2.ppc64le.rpm chromium-l10n-101.0.4951.64-2.noarch.rpm
but all (except chromium-l10n-101.0.4951.64-2.noarch) gives me an error message:
- nothing provides libjsoncpp.so.24()(64bit) needed by chromium-101.0.4951.64-2.ppc64le
- nothing provides libwebp.so.6()(64bit) needed by chromium-101.0.4951.64-2.ppc64le
which I could not find on the web.
Package chromium-l10n-101.0.4951.64-2.noarch gives me a different error: file /usr/lib from install of chromium-l10n-101.0.4951.64-2.noarch conflicts with file from package filesystem-3.16-2.fc36.ppc64le
Any ideas?
